Discover Respond JS from Scratch – Finish Novice to Advanced Guidebook

Contemporary Net enhancement is evolving swiftly, and React happens to be One of the more powerful applications for creating interactive user interfaces. Irrespective of whether you're a beginner stepping into programming or perhaps a developer aiming to improve your skills, deciding on to find out React JS from scratchLinks to an external web-site. can open doorways to countless prospects in the tech market. Respond is widely employed by startups and enormous businesses alike thanks to its versatility, overall performance, and component-dependent architecture.

This guide will allow you to find out React JS from scratch with a structured approach, functional methods, and obvious explanations so that you can transfer from beginner to Innovative degree confidently.

Understanding React and Why It Issues
React is often a JavaScript library used for constructing speedy and dynamic user interfaces. Made by Facebook, it simplifies the process of developing elaborate World wide web apps by breaking them into reusable parts.

If you understand Respond JS from scratch, you start to understand how modern Internet purposes manage facts and update the interface successfully devoid of reloading the page.

Essential Capabilities of React
Respond supplies a number of functions that make improvement a lot quicker and even more efficient:

Part-dependent architecture

Virtual DOM for faster updates

Reusable code construction

Solid Local community support

By choosing to discover Respond JS from scratch, builders attain the chance to Construct scalable apps with clean up and maintainable code.

Conditions Before you begin
Before you learn React JS from scratch, it’s crucial that you Possess a fundamental understanding of some Main World-wide-web systems.

HTML and CSS Fundamentals
React builds user interfaces, so being aware of how HTML constructions web pages And exactly how CSS styles them is essential.

JavaScript Basic principles
A strong understanding of JavaScript will make it much easier to master Respond JS from scratch. Concentrate on ideas like:

Variables and features

Arrays and objects

ES6 features like arrow capabilities and destructuring

Claims and asynchronous programming

Owning these competencies will help you development faster whenever you learn Respond JS from scratch.

Creating Your React Advancement Atmosphere
To properly discover Respond JS from scratch, you need the ideal equipment set up in your program.

Get started by setting up Node.js and npm, which might be needed for handling packages. You'll be able to develop your to start with React software working with applications like Make React App or Vite.

When your ecosystem is prepared, you could start experimenting with components, props, and state while you discover Respond JS from scratch via arms-on coding.

Learning Main React Ideas
Comprehending the core ideas is The key component any time you discover React JS from scratch.

Factors
Components tend to be the creating blocks of React programs. Each individual element signifies a bit of the person interface.

Whenever you understand React JS from scratch, you can expect to explore how factors help Manage code and improve maintainability.

Props and Condition
Props allow information to move between elements, even though condition manages dynamic details in just a component.

Mastering props and state is essential in order to certainly study React JS from scratch and develop interactive programs.

Celebration click here to find out more Dealing with
Respond causes it to be simple to answer consumer steps such as clicks, kind submissions, and keyboard enter.

As you go on to understand React JS from scratch, you’ll observe dealing with events to create responsive and interesting interfaces.

Dealing with Respond Hooks
React Hooks revolutionized how builders regulate condition and lifecycle logic in functional components.

useState Hook
The useState hook allows developers to store and update ingredient facts. Once you master Respond JS from scratch, this hook will become one of the most normally used resources in your tasks.

useEffect Hook
The useEffect hook allows take care of Unwanted effects including API calls, information fetching, and DOM updates.

Understanding hooks deeply is likely to make your journey to find out Respond JS from scratch A lot smoother and even more successful.

Creating Practical Jobs
Theory alone is just not sufficient any time you learn Respond JS from scratch. Realistic assignments are the best way to improve your knowledge.

Start with modest applications for example:

To-do record apps

Weather purposes

Basic dashboards

When you go on to understand React JS from scratch, step by step move toward extra intricate assignments like e-commerce interfaces or social media dashboards.

Making projects not merely enhances coding abilities but in addition will help create a strong developer portfolio.

Exploring State-of-the-art React Topics
Once you are comfortable with the basics, the following stage to master Respond JS from scratch is Checking out Innovative concepts.

Respond Router
React Router lets builders to produce multi-page encounters in a one-web page software.

Condition Administration with Redux
Redux is a popular condition management library that assists handle software-wide information.

When you actually want to understand Respond JS from scratch and develop into position-Prepared, being familiar with Redux and State-of-the-art condition management is highly worthwhile.

Greatest Methods for Discovering React
To successfully study Respond JS from scratch, next a structured Studying system is essential.

Follow coding each day, browse official documentation, and discover open-supply tasks. Signing up for developer communities and collaborating with Many others can even accelerate your progress.

The more you experiment and Establish, the much easier it will become to learn Respond JS from scratch and learn the framework.

Summary
Respond carries on to dominate modern day front-end progress, which makes it The most beneficial competencies for developers today. By having a structured approach and making genuine-entire world tasks, anyone can learn React JS from scratch and gradually development from novice to State-of-the-art amount.

The important thing is consistency, follow, and curiosity. If you dedicate the perfect time to studying Main concepts, experimenting with parts, and creating simple programs, your journey to understand React JS from scratch will become both satisfying and profession-shifting. With persistence and the proper Mastering route, you can transform your capabilities and become a self-assured Respond developer.

Leave a Reply

Your email address will not be published. Required fields are marked *